Is Mansfield Apartments Safe?
Not really — crime is above the national average. Mansfield Apartments in New Haven, CT has a safety grade of C-. The overall crime index is 163, which is 63% above the national average of 100.
Compared to the New Haven average (crime index 149), Mansfield Apartments is 14% higher in overall crime.
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 195, 95%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 49).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
